### What changes were proposed in this pull request?
Test is flaky (https://github.com/apache/spark/runs/3109815586):
```
Traceback (most recent call last):
File "/__w/spark/spark/python/pyspark/mllib/tests/test_streaming_algorithms.py", line 391, in test_parameter_convergence
eventually(condition, catch_assertions=True)
File "/__w/spark/spark/python/pyspark/testing/utils.py", line 91, in eventually
raise lastValue
File "/__w/spark/spark/python/pyspark/testing/utils.py", line 82, in eventually
lastValue = condition()
File "/__w/spark/spark/python/pyspark/mllib/tests/test_streaming_algorithms.py", line 387, in condition
self.assertEqual(len(model_weights), len(batches))
AssertionError: 9 != 10
```
Should probably increase timeout
### Why are the changes needed?
To avoid flakiness in the test.
### Does this PR introduce _any_ user-facing change?
Nope, dev-only.
### How was this patch tested?
CI should test it out.
Closes#33427 from HyukjinKwon/SPARK-36216.
Authored-by: Hyukjin Kwon <gurwls223@apache.org>
Signed-off-by: Hyukjin Kwon <gurwls223@apache.org>
(cherry picked from commit d6b974f8ce)
Signed-off-by: Hyukjin Kwon <gurwls223@apache.org>